Open main menu
Home
Random
Log in
Settings
About Sugar Labs
Disclaimers
Sugar Labs
Search
Changes
← Older edit
Dextrose/Updater
(view source)
Revision as of 00:33, 17 May 2016
212 bytes added
,
00:33, 17 May 2016
no edit summary
Line 1:
Line 1:
+
{{Obsolete|Moved and died at https://sugardextrose.org/projects/dextrose/wiki/Dextrose_3_Updater}}
+
== Configuration ==
== Configuration ==
−
Edit {{Code|/etc/default/dextrose-update}} configuration file:
+
Edit {{Code|/etc/default/dextrose-update}} configuration file
to set space separated list of yum repositories
:
−
DEXTROSE_YUM_REPO=
''name-of-yum-repository-with-
dextrose-
packages''
+
DEXTROSE_YUM_REPO=
"dextrose
dextrose-
freeworld"
== Install ==
== Install ==
Line 19:
Line 21:
relogin_pkgs="sugar sugar-artwork sugar-base sugar-datastore sugar-presence-service sugar-toolkit"
relogin_pkgs="sugar sugar-artwork sugar-base sugar-datastore sugar-presence-service sugar-toolkit"
−
yum="/usr/bin/yum --disablerepo=*
--enablerepo=${DEXTROSE_YUM_REPO}
--skip-broken --quiet"
+
yum="/usr/bin/yum --disablerepo=* --skip-broken --quiet"
+
for i in $DEXTROSE_YUM_REPOS; do
+
yum="$yum --enablerepo=$i"
+
done
updates() {
updates() {
Line 61:
Line 66:
ln -s /usr/sbin/dextrose-update /etc/cron.daily/
ln -s /usr/sbin/dextrose-update /etc/cron.daily/
−
Python client code:
+
Python client code
for {{Code|src/jarabe/model/notifications.py}}
:
_DBUS_SYSTEM_IFACE = 'org.sugarlabs.system'
_DBUS_SYSTEM_IFACE = 'org.sugarlabs.system'
Davelab6
Administrators
534
edits